The Sherlockian by Graham Moore

3.0

This was actually more of a compelling read than I thought it would be in the first chapter. That being said, the ending of both stories was a let down. The one involving Arthur struck me as more realistic than the one involving Harold, but neither of them were satisfying. And this, despite much discussion in the plot of what makes a mystery satisfying. I did like the info on Bram Stoker and Oscar Wilde and Conan Doyle, though -- it made Stoker a more appealing figure for me. And I agreed with him that the stories they all wrote live forever and are more real in many ways than the authors themselves.
